Two small sites are nestled along the edge of this lake. Each site offers the basic amenities of tables, fire rings and a pit toilet with natural camping pads. The sites have separate vehicle access points (300m apart) and are connected by a short trail along the lake. The lake is suitable and accessible for canoe use.

Directions

Travel 9 km west of Prince George from hwy 97/16 junction - turn left on to the Blackwater Rd - proceed 21 km and turn right on to the Pelican FSR. Turn left at 41.5 km. The site is located at 3.2 km along the "A" Rd. Alternatively this site can be accessed from the Bobtail FSR, 35 minutes west of PG, turn off the highway (left) and travel 20 km, then turn left onto the Blackwater Road (travel 30k m); this will connect you to the Pelican FSR at 35.5 km.
